题解 1046: [编程入门]自定义函数之数字后移

来看看其他人写的题解吧!要先自己动手做才会有提高哦! 
返回题目 | 我来写题解

筛选

自定义函数之数字后移,新手易懂

摘要:解题思路:用两个数组,数组a来存放输入的数据,数组b来存放后移后的数据。在代码中i+m>=n是用来判断a数组末尾几个数据后移后是否会超出a中所输入数据的长度,超出部分数据依次从b[0]向后存放注意事项……

循环解决数字后移问题

摘要:解题思路:用两个数组即可解决此题,第一个数组用于存储用户输入的数据,第二个数组用于存储交换后的数据把第一个数组的1~8位存入第二个数组的3~10位,9,10位存入1,2位再输出即可注意事项:参考代码:……

用冒泡排序的方法解决

摘要:解题思路: 通过交换相邻元素的方式将元素依次向前移动一位,实现将数组的后 m 个元素循环前移到数组前面。注意事项: 注意输入的 m 值不能超过数组的长度,否则可能会出现越界错误。代码中使用了变长数组(……

简单易懂 给个赞 嘻嘻

摘要:解题思路:很简单注意事项:注意考虑周到参考代码:#include<stdio.h>#define N 10000void text(int * a , int n1 , int n2){&……

不用指针,纯数组

摘要:解题思路:注意事项:参考代码:#include<stdio.h>int a[50];void ChangeArray(int n,int m){ int i; for(i=n-1;i>=0;i--) ……

[编程入门]自定义函数之数字后移-题解(C语言代码)

摘要:虽然题目要求的是数组的求解,在看了通过的情况,大多数的同学都是可以完成的,因此,由于这道题的规律性,我联想到了链表,因此我提供一种链表求解 思路:首先需要会链表啊,其次将headptr与lastpt……